All offences ·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Armley Road area has the 7th lowest crime rate of 78 local areas in Anfield , and the 353rd lowest crime rate of 1,559 local areas in Liverpool .
This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Armley Road (L4 2UW) in the last 12 months was 36.0 per 1,000 residents and was 74.5% lower than the Anfield average (141.1 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 7 offences recorded. The least common crime was Anti-social behaviour with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Violence and sexual offences ( 133.3% YoY). The sharpest decline was Drugs ( -33.3%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 8 (≈ 24.0 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 166.7%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-51.4%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Armley Road (L4 2UW),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Abbey Road, where police recorded 58 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Canon Road (25 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
